Now we know, that chip R600 will be issued in 0.08 micron technical process, and chip G80 will be inl 0.09 micron .
Fortunately, Japanese site on this theme has published some reasons on current week. Having used a subjunctive mood, the Japanese colleagues argued on that, " as it would be good, if chip R600 was made on 0.065 microns ". The matter is that necessity of support DirectX 10 and transition on unified shader architecture has caused increase in number of transistors by 40 % in comparison with the R580. It means, that the number of transistors in R600 will increase by about 384 million to the size exceeding 500 million of transistors.
By itself, all those transistors need be placed on one crystal. core R580 has the area 342 mm. Transition to more "thin" 0.08 microns technical process will allow to receive some economy in the core area , as a result R600 will have the area of a kernel of the order 380 . Mm. As you can see, the increase in number of transistors by 40 % was expressed only in 10 % increase in the core area . Quite good result :).
Meanwhile, if ATI has selected for R600 the 0.065 microns technical process ,the core area would be reduced up to 250 Mm, this is alone a potential of power requirement reduction . Now, when R600 should be made in 0.08, its power requirement level should exceed the one of R580 by approximately 1.6 times. It means, that consumation by videocards on the basis of chip R600 in power can pass for 200 w - in full loading .
Whether G80 will be more economic, in fact the chip will remains in the outdated 0.09 microns .from calculations, and nvidia data : videocards on the basis of chip G80 will consume about175 w. For comparison - GeForce 7900 GTX eat 120 w, for GeForce 7950 GX2 - 143 w.
